Exactly How Fall Weather Affects Blood Sugar Levels



Temperature changes affect just how the body processes insulin and handles glucose degrees. When temperatures drop in the early morning and evening, capillary tighten a little, which can influence flow and insulin absorption. This physical reaction means that insulin shots might function differently than they did throughout warmer months, potentially causing unforeseen changes in blood sugar analyses.

The cooler climate likewise often tends to enhance appetite, as bodies naturally long for much more considerable, heating foods. This shift in nutritional preferences can make section control a lot more difficult, particularly when home cooking come to be extra enticing. Campbell residents typically observe this change as October and November bring requests for heartier dishes and seasonal treats that weren't as appealing during the summer warmth.

Decreased daylight hours influence activity levels as well. With sundown taking place earlier daily, many people naturally invest less time outdoors and end up being a lot more sedentary. This reduction in physical activity straight impacts insulin sensitivity and glucose monitoring, making it tougher to keep stable blood sugar levels without readjusting medication or workout regimens.

Taking Care Of Diabetes Technology in Cooler Weather



Continual glucose screens and insulin pumps need special attention during temperature level adjustments. These devices function most successfully within particular temperature level varieties, and direct exposure to cold morning air during strolls or time invested in air-conditioned structures can influence their accuracy and function. Maintaining tools near the body under layers of clothes maintains correct operating temperatures.

Testing supplies require security from temperature level extremes too. Blood sugar meters might offer inaccurate readings when as well cool, so maintaining them inside the home rather than in cars parked outdoors preserves their integrity. Examination strips should stay sealed in their initial containers, kept away from dampness that enhances during fall's greater moisture levels in Santa Clara County.

Preventing Fall-Related Complications



Nerve damages from diabetes raises fall danger, an issue that magnifies during fall when wet fallen leaves cover pathways and much shorter days indicate more movement occurs in decreased illumination. Campbell's tree-lined roads come to be specifically tough after rainfall, when slippery surface areas require additional caution. Home safety analyses recognize potential hazards like loosened carpets, inadequate lighting, or chaotic pathways that could create injuries.

Footwear options matter extra during autumn months. Closed-toe shoes with good grip offer much better stability than shoes put on during summertime. Normal foot examinations capture possible problems before they develop into significant problems, particularly essential since decreased sensation could stop early awareness of sores or inflammation from new footwear.

Vision modifications related to diabetic issues call for additional focus as lights conditions change. Setting up brighter light bulbs in hallways, stairs, and shower rooms boosts learn more visibility during morning and evening hours. Evening lights along typical pathways protect against mishaps during nighttime shower room gos to, when disorientation from sleep makes drops more likely.

Preparing for Holiday Season Challenges



Thanksgiving notes the beginning of a tough duration for diabetic issues management, as parties focused around food end up being frequent. Planning in advance for these events minimizes stress and anxiety and enhances outcomes. Reviewing drug routines before gatherings, eating a tiny balanced snack before events, and remaining hydrated aid maintain stable blood sugar level degrees even when meal timing varies from normal routines.

Traveling to family members celebrations requires additional prep work. Loading more supplies than needed, lugging medications in carry-on bags, and preserving testing timetables regardless of disrupted routines avoids problems.
